UN Forklift expands factory

Chinese manufacturer UN Forklift has expanded its plant to meet the rapid demand growth of the past two years.

The new assembly line was recently commissioned, resulting in a significant increase in production capacity. The new assembly line will add an additional 10,000 units per year.

The expansion spans an area of 940 sqm, and includes 12 mainline stations and seven sub-assembly stations. 

The new assembly line mainly produces mainstream products, including counterbalance internal combustion engine and LPG forklifts. 

According to a company statement, the line includes the latest technology and has significantly improved production efficiency and product quality. This enables UN Forklift to serve customers better and greatly improve customer satisfaction.

Founded in 1978, UN Forklift Co. manufactures 17 varieties, 96 series and more than 200 specifications of materials handling equipment.
